GHS Wrestling Hosts 9/11 Tribute
Posted on 09/10/2021

The Grapevine High School wrestling team hosted its second annual 9/11 Tribute Climb on Friday, September 10, in the visitor stands at Mustang Panther Stadium. The Mustangs started the tradition last year as a way to pay tribute to the heroes of 9/11.

In partnership with local authorities such as the Grapevine Fire Department and Grapevine Police Department, team members and first responders replicated climbing the 110 flights of stairs that first responders in New York City climbed inside the World Trade Center on September 11, 2001.

In addition to climbing the stairs, first responders and many members of the wrestling team also carried weighted vests or backpacks to simulate the weight carried by 9/11 first responders.
